Filament foundation for HiTaqnia Laravel applications.
haykal-filament ships the base classes, middlewares, theme, and Huwiya integration that every HiTaqnia Filament panel uses. Installing this package gives an application a complete panel baseline — authentication via Huwiya, tenant-aware middleware stack, opinionated UI defaults, a shared theme, and a convention-driven resource discovery layout — so panel definitions stay focused on the concrete resources, pages, and navigation of each panel.

Installation
With hitaqnia/haykal-core already wired (see its README), require this package alongside:
composer require hitaqnia/haykal-filament
That single require is enough — Phosphor icons (codeat3/blade-phosphor-icons via tonegabes/filament-phosphor-icons) are pulled transitively, so every alias declared in config/haykal-filament-icons.php resolves out of the box. The ToneGabes\Filament\Icons\Enums\Phosphor enum is also available for typed icon references in resources, navigation items, and form components.
Configuration
1. Register the Huwiya web guard
In config/auth.php, register a guard for every panel that uses Huwiya authentication. The guard driver must be huwiya-web:
'guards' => [ // ... existing guards ... 'web' => [ 'driver' => 'huwiya-web', 'provider' => 'users', ], ],
Panels may each use their own named guard (admin, residents, …). Filament resolves the guard for the active panel via Filament::getAuthGuard().
2. Scaffold the panel theme
Run the publish-theme command once per panel:
php artisan haykal:publish-theme admin
The command scaffolds resources/css/filament/admin/theme.css. The scaffold @imports Filament's default theme and the Haykal base theme directly from the vendor directory, plus the correct Tailwind 4 @source directives for the panel's paths. Because both imports reference vendor paths, updates to either flow through composer update without republishing. Register the panel theme in vite.config.js:
laravel({ input: [ 'resources/css/app.css', 'resources/js/app.js', 'resources/css/filament/admin/theme.css', ], });
Wire the panel theme through BasePanel::customizePanel():
protected function customizePanel(Panel $panel): Panel { return $panel->viteTheme('resources/css/filament/admin/theme.css'); }
3. Publish the icon overrides (optional)
Icon overrides are merged into config.filament.icons automatically. Publish the config file only if per-application tweaks are needed:
php artisan vendor:publish --tag=haykal-filament-icons
Defining panels
Subclass BasePanel for every panel. The minimum viable panel declares only an id and a customization hook; everything else — login page, middleware stack, plugins, defaults — is inherited.
namespace App\Providers\Panels; use App\Models\Complex; use Filament\Panel; use HiTaqnia\Haykal\Filament\BasePanel; final class ManagementPanelProvider extends BasePanel { protected function getId(): string { return 'management'; } protected function customizePanel(Panel $panel): Panel { return $panel ->brandName('Management') ->viteTheme('resources/css/filament/management/theme.css'); } protected function tenantModel(): ?string { return Complex::class; } protected function tenantSlugAttribute(): ?string { return 'slug'; } }
Register the provider in bootstrap/providers.php. Panels without tenancy (super-admin dashboards, system settings) return null from tenantModel() and skip the tenant middleware stack.
Multiple tenant types: one panel per type
Filament binds exactly one tenant model per panel, so applications with multiple tenant types (for example, Agency and Development Company) implement one panel per type. Each panel declares its own tenant model, middleware stack, login route, and URL prefix; users working with Agencies sign in at /agency/... and never see Developer resources, and vice versa.
final class AgencyPanelProvider extends BasePanel { protected function getId(): string { return 'agency'; } protected function tenantModel(): ?string { return Agency::class; } protected function tenantSlugAttribute(): ?string { return 'slug'; } protected function customizePanel(Panel $panel): Panel { /* ... */ } } final class DevelopmentCompanyPanelProvider extends BasePanel { protected function getId(): string { return 'developers'; } protected function tenantModel(): ?string { return DevelopmentCompany::class; } protected function tenantSlugAttribute(): ?string { return 'slug'; } protected function customizePanel(Panel $panel): Panel { /* ... */ } }
FilamentTenancyMiddleware stores whichever tenant the active panel resolves into Tenancy::setTenantId(...) as a single value — only one tenant type is active per request. Resources on each panel declare their own $tenantForeignKey (see haykal-core's "Multiple tenant types" section) so queries filter on the correct column (agency_id for Property, developer_id for Project) against that single active id.

Locale-aware fonts
BasePanel calls Filament's Panel::font(...) with a closure that resolves the font family from the active locale on every render — switching the user's language switches the panel's typography on the next request. Defaults:
| Locale | Font |
|---|---|
en (and any unknown locale) |
Outfit |
ar |
Tajawal |
ku |
Noto Sans Arabic |
Fonts load through Filament's BunnyFontProvider (the Google Fonts mirror Filament ships with), so no app-side font hosting or build-step is required.
To swap fonts per locale, override fontFamiliesByLocale():
final class ManagementPanelProvider extends BasePanel { // ... protected function fontFamiliesByLocale(): array { return [ 'default' => 'Inter', // every locale not listed below falls back here 'ar' => 'Cairo', 'ku' => 'Vazirmatn', ]; } }
The 'default' key is the safety net — any locale not in the map falls through to it.
Global Filament defaults
BaseFilamentServiceProvider is an application-side provider that applies HiTaqnia's shared Filament UX defaults across every panel. Subclass it in your application, register the subclass in bootstrap/providers.php, and the defaults boot once per request.
namespace App\Providers; use HiTaqnia\Haykal\Filament\BaseFilamentServiceProvider; final class FilamentServiceProvider extends BaseFilamentServiceProvider { // Inherit every default. Override individual configure*() hooks // when an app needs to relax or extend a single concern. }
What the base applies
| Hook | Default behavior |
|---|---|
configureModalDefaults() |
ModalComponent::closedByClickingAway(false) — modals never auto-close on outside click. |
configureActionDefaults() |
CreateAction defaults to createAnother(false). |
configureTableDefaults() |
Column manager and filters render in a slide-over with no cancel button; filters use FiltersLayout::Modal. |
configureTextDefaults() |
TextColumn and TextEntry get an em-dash (—) placeholder, plus a "Click to copy" tooltip on copyable instances. The tooltip resolves through the package translation namespace haykal-filament::copyable.tooltip (English / Arabic / Kurdish ship in the box). |
Per-call configuration always wins — calling ->placeholder('...') or ->tooltip(...) on a column or entry overrides the default for that instance.
Extending
Each concern is its own protected method, so an app subclass replaces only what it needs:
final class FilamentServiceProvider extends BaseFilamentServiceProvider { // Allow modals to close on outside click in this app. protected function configureModalDefaults(): void { ModalComponent::closedByClickingAway(true); } // Add an extra default on top of the base's text defaults. protected function configureTextDefaults(): void { parent::configureTextDefaults(); TextColumn::configureUsing(static function (TextColumn $column): void { $column->size(TextColumn\TextColumnSize::Small); }); } }
To skip a hook entirely, override it with an empty body. To replace a tooltip translation, either change the active locale or publish the package translations and edit them locally:
php artisan vendor:publish --tag=haykal-filament-translations
Published files land at lang/vendor/haykal-filament/{en,ar,ku}/copyable.php.

Theming
resources/css/base-theme.css is the single shared theme — an opinionated, fully-skinned Filament look inspired by polished SaaS dashboards: dark near-black sidebar with orange accents, light airy content area, flat surfaces (no shadows except on overlays), rounded corners, and gentle motion. Every panel imports it directly from the vendor directory, so updates flow through composer update.
The haykal:publish-theme command scaffolds a per-panel theme file; subsequent runs skip existing files unless --force is passed. A scaffolded panel theme looks like:
@import '../../../../vendor/filament/filament/resources/css/theme.css'; @import '../../../../vendor/hitaqnia/haykal-filament/resources/css/base-theme.css'; @source '../../../../app/Panels/Management/**/*.php'; @source '../../../../resources/views/filament/management/**/*.blade.php'; /* Management panel overrides go below. */
Tailwind 4 CSS-first configuration lives entirely in the panel theme file — the package does not publish any Tailwind config. Extend the @source list for application-specific content paths.
Re-skinning via tokens
The base theme exposes its color/radius/elevation system as CSS tokens declared in a @theme {} block. Override any of them in a panel's own @theme {} block placed after the @import to re-skin without forking the file:
@import '../../../../vendor/filament/filament/resources/css/theme.css'; @import '../../../../vendor/hitaqnia/haykal-filament/resources/css/base-theme.css'; @source '../../../../app/Panels/Management/**/*.php'; @theme { --filament-primary-rgb: 16 129 105; /* swap accent */ --filament-shell: #0c1117; /* darker sidebar */ --filament-radius: 1rem; /* rounder cards */ }
Forking
When token overrides aren't enough, publish the file:
php artisan vendor:publish --tag=haykal-filament-theme
After publishing, update each panel theme's @import to point at the local copy (resources/css/haykal/base-theme.css). This opts out of upstream updates — prefer the @theme {} token-override approach whenever the change can be expressed that way.

Translatable forms
Multi-language form fields belong inside TranslatableTabs:
use HiTaqnia\Haykal\Filament\Forms\TranslatableTabs; use Filament\Forms\Components\Textarea; use Filament\Forms\Components\TextInput; TranslatableTabs::make('translations') ->languages(config('app.supported_locales')) ->primaryLanguage('ar') ->requirePrimaryLanguageOnly() ->fields([ TextInput::make('name')->required(), Textarea::make('description'), ]);
The component clones each declared field per locale, binding state paths to <field>.<locale>. Tab icons reflect state at a glance: filled (check), required-but-empty (warning), or optional-and-empty (dashed circle).

Reactive configuration via closures
mapHeight, mapCenter, mapZoom, and navigationControl accept either a static value or a Filament-style closure. Closures resolve the same named/typed injections as any other Filament closure ($state, $get, $set, $record, $livewire, …) and are re-evaluated on every render — pair them with a live() source field to drive the map from another component:
use Filament\Forms\Components\Select; use Filament\Schemas\Components\Utilities\Get; use HiTaqnia\Haykal\Filament\Mapbox\Components\MapboxLocationPicker; Select::make('city') ->options([ 'baghdad' => 'Baghdad', 'erbil' => 'Erbil', ]) ->live(); MapboxLocationPicker::make('coordinates') ->mapCenter(fn (Get $get): array => match ($get('city')) { 'baghdad' => [44.3661, 33.3152], 'erbil' => [44.0090, 36.1900], default => [-74.5, 40.0], }) ->mapZoom(fn (Get $get): int => $get('city') ? 12 : 9);
Switching the city Select re-renders the picker with a fresh center and zoom — no manual afterStateUpdated() plumbing required.
Assets
Both the Mapbox GL CSS (mapbox-gl.css, mapbox-gl-draw.css) and the compiled Alpine bundles for each component are registered with Filament automatically via HaykalFilamentServiceProvider. The bundles are loaded on request — pages that do not reference a Mapbox component pay no runtime cost.
The bundles are built from resources/js/mapbox/components/*.js with esbuild and committed under resources/js/mapbox/dist/. After editing any source module, refresh them from inside the package:
cd packages/haykal-filament
npm install
npm run build
Right-to-left text
Every component initializes mapbox-gl-rtl-text on the first map render, so Arabic, Hebrew, and Persian labels join correctly instead of rendering as disconnected glyphs. The plugin is registered with lazy-loading (the third argument to setRTLTextPlugin), so its script is only fetched the first time a tile actually contains RTL text — non-RTL maps pay nothing.
The registration is idempotent across all four components (Mapbox throws if setRTLTextPlugin runs twice), and the plugin URL is pinned to the version embedded in the package bundles. No application configuration is required.
